A masculine noun is used with masculine articles and adjectives (e.g., el hombre guapo, el sol amarillo).
masculine noun
a. farmer
El quintero decidió comenzar a cultivar aceitunas.The farmer decided to start growing olives.
a. farmhand
A los quinteros se les paga por quincena.The farmhands are paid every other week.
b. farm laborer
Regionalism used in the United States
(United States)
Uno de los quinteros se lastimó con la guadaña.One of the farm laborers hurt himself with the scythe.
c. farm labourer
Regionalism used in the United Kingdom
(United Kingdom)
La cosecha se terminó y todos los quinteros regresaron a sus casas.The harvest season is over and all the farm labourers returned home.
